What is the name of the Greek muse dedicated to dance?

The muse of dance, also known as Terpsichore, is one of the nine muses of Greek mythology and is responsible for inspiring and protecting dancers in their art. Terpsichore means «she who delights in dance.»

According to legend, Terpsichore was one of the most beautiful and elegant muses of all.. She was depicted with a lyre and a laurel wreath, symbols of her skill in music and poetry, as well as dance.

During ancient Greece, dance was a highly valued art form. The muse of dance was very important in the field of performing arts and entertainment.

The influence of Terpsichore also extends to the present, since dance is one of the most popular and appreciated arts throughout the world. Numerous works of art, both in figurative art and literature, represent this important muse in Greek mythology.
